
Dominican University of California
University Information
Dominican University of California is an independent university offering the best of the liberal arts combined with rigorous professional education. Founded in 1890, Dominican enjoys a century-long reputation for excellence in scholarship, research, and community outreach.
The University offers more than 50 academic programs that reflect the diversity and creativity of the faculty and students.
With more than 2,200 graduate and undergraduate students and a student to faculty ratio of 10:1, Dominican is able to successfully blend personal attention associated with smaller schools with the academic resources of a larger university. Dominican is one of the oldest universities in California.
